Sunex 1330 Steel Brake Drum Handler, Adjustable for 15 and 16.5 inch Drums, 63 inch Length
- The Sunex 1330 steel brake drum handler safely lifts, installs, and transports 15 inch and 16.5 inch brake drums for Class 7 and 8 tractor and trailer applications. Its adjustable angle bracket, drive screw carriage, and 8 inch rubber wheels maximize ease of use without requiring manual lifting.
- Features:
- Adjustable bracket secures brake drums of 15 inch and 16.5 inch sizes.
- Drive screw with machine-style handle smoothly raises and lowers the carriage.
- 8 inch rubber pneumatic wheels allow easy movement on shop floors.
- Removable handle facilitates compact storage.
- Overall length of 63 inches accommodates large brake drums and provides leverage.

Q: What drum sizes does this handler support?
A: It handles brake drums of 15 inches and 16.5 inches supported by most Class 7 and 8 trailer brake systems.
Q: How does the carriage adjust height?
A: The drive screw mechanism operated by a machine-style handle smoothly raises and lowers the carriage between 10.25 inches and 15.25 inches.
Q: Are the wheels suitable for shop floors?
A: Yes. The 8 inch rubber pneumatic wheels roll easily over typical shop surface with good shock absorption.
